在计算机科学的世界里,网络连接问题就像是一面镜子,能反映出我们系统背后的种种问题。而CMD命令行工具中的“ping”命令,就像是一把钥匙,能帮助我们轻松地打开这扇门,了解网络连接的状况。今天,就让我带你一起探索如何使用CMD命令ping数据库,以及如何通过这个小小的技巧来排查网络连接问题。
什么是ping命令?
首先,让我们来认识一下ping命令。ping是一个网络诊断工具,用于测试网络连接。它通过向目标服务器发送数据包并等待响应,来检查网络连接是否正常。这个命令在Windows系统中非常实用,可以帮助我们快速定位网络问题。
为什么使用ping命令来ping数据库?
数据库作为现代应用程序的核心组成部分,其稳定性和可访问性至关重要。使用ping命令来ping数据库,可以帮助我们:
- 检查数据库服务器是否在线。
- 检测网络延迟。
- 识别网络丢包情况。
如何在CMD中使用ping命令ping数据库?
下面是使用ping命令ping数据库的步骤:
- 打开CMD窗口:按下Win + R键,输入
cmd并按Enter键。 - 输入ping命令:在CMD窗口中输入
ping 数据库名或IP地址,然后按Enter键。
例如,如果你要ping一个名为mydatabase的数据库,或者知道其IP地址为192.168.1.100,你可以这样操作:
ping mydatabase
或者
ping 192.168.1.100
分析ping命令的输出结果
当你按下Enter键后,CMD会开始发送数据包到指定的数据库服务器。以下是如何分析ping命令的输出结果:
- TTL(生存时间):这个数字表示数据包在网络中的最大传输时间,通常为64或128。
- TTL过期:如果TTL过期,这可能意味着数据包在传输过程中被路由器丢弃。
- 数据包丢失:如果ping命令返回数据包丢失,这可能意味着网络连接存在问题。
- 响应时间:这个数字表示数据包往返的时间,通常以毫秒为单位。
实际案例
假设我们ping一个IP地址为192.168.1.100的数据库,输出结果如下:
Pinging 192.168.1.100 with 32 bytes of data:
Reply from 192.168.1.100: bytes=32 time=10ms TTL=64
Reply from 192.168.1.100: bytes=32 time=10ms TTL=64
Reply from 192.168.1.100: bytes=32 time=10ms TTL=64
Reply from 192.168.1.100: bytes=32 time=10ms TTL=64
Ping statistics for 192.168.1.100:
Packets: Sent = 4, Received = 4, Lost = 0 (0% loss),
Approximate round trip times in milli-seconds:
Minimum = 10ms, Maximum = 10ms, Average = 10ms
从这个输出结果中,我们可以看出:
- 数据库服务器在线。
- 网络延迟为10毫秒。
- 没有数据包丢失。
总结
使用CMD命令ping数据库是一个简单而有效的方法,可以帮助我们快速排查网络连接问题。通过分析ping命令的输出结果,我们可以了解数据库服务器的在线状态、网络延迟和数据包丢失情况。希望这篇文章能帮助你更好地掌握这个技巧,让你的数据库运行更加稳定可靠。
